Giants’ Daniel Jones ranked amongst NFL’s 10 worst contracts in 2024

There are many unhealthy contracts today within the NFL as revenues and the wage cap have risen exponentially over the previous decade.

A type of contracts, says David Kenyon of Bleacher Report, is the one the New York Giants signed quarterback Daniel Jones to in March of 2023 — a four-year, $160 million deal of which $92 million is assured.

Kenyon listed his 10 worst contracts of the upcoming season in a current article. Jones’ deal got here in at No. 10.

On the time, it appeared like an pointless threat for a participant who’d by no means been something above a league-average quarterback. Then, he struggled badly in six video games earlier than a knee damage final 12 months.

In 2024, Jones’ cap quantity is simply wanting $47.9 million. Maybe he places collectively a resurgent season after the Giants drafted vast receiver Malik Nabers and bolstered the offensive line.

If not, nonetheless, releasing Jones subsequent offseason would imply he nonetheless counts $19.4 million in opposition to the 2025 cap. That’s an actual chance, but it’ll sting anyway.

The fact is that the contract isn’t as restrictive as one would possibly suppose. The Giants can shred themselves of Jones after this season, as Kenyon talked about, with a palatable useless cap cost.

$19.4 million isn’t a cap-killer any longer. With the wage cap growing almost 10 p.c each season, it’s successful the Giants can simply soak up.

As many know, the crew was angling for a successor on this 12 months’s draft however the appropriate state of affairs didn’t current itself. Ought to Jones falter or be injured once more this season, you may be sure the Giants will likely be shifting on.
